α-Methyl-4-[(trifluoromethyl)thio]benzenemethanol

Description:
α-Methyl-4-[(trifluoromethyl)thio]benzenemethanol, with the CAS number 21101-66-6, is an organic compound characterized by its unique functional groups and structural features. It contains a benzene ring substituted with a methyl group and a trifluoromethylthio group, which significantly influences its chemical properties. The presence of the trifluoromethyl group imparts notable electronegativity and lipophilicity, affecting the compound's reactivity and interaction with biological systems. The hydroxyl (-OH) group in the benzenemethanol structure contributes to its potential as a hydrogen bond donor, enhancing solubility in polar solvents. This compound may exhibit interesting pharmacological properties due to its structural characteristics, making it a subject of interest in medicinal chemistry. Additionally, the trifluoromethylthio moiety can enhance metabolic stability and alter the compound's biological activity. Overall, α-Methyl-4-[(trifluoromethyl)thio]benzenemethanol is a complex molecule with potential applications in various fields, including p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als.
Formula:C9H9F3OS
InChI:InChI=1S/C9H9F3OS/c1-6(13)7-2-4-8(5-3-7)14-9(10,11)12/h2-6,13H,1H3
InChI key:InChIKey=HSJRMALTSZKPOV-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:S(C(F)(F)F)C1=CC=C(C(C)O)C=C1
Synonyms:
  • Benzenemethanol, α-methyl-4-[(trifluoromethyl)thio]-
  • α-Methyl-4-[(trifluoromethyl)thio]benzenemethanol
  • 1-(4-Trifluoromethylthiophenyl)ethanol
  • Benzyl alcohol, α-methyl-p-[(trifluoromethyl)thio]-
